I like X because since partner has Passed, it seems very unlikely we will get past 3NT before it comes back to me. The plan is to rebid clubs (17+) later. Had partner not been a Passed hand, it's a bit more dangerous. I guess I would have bid 2C.

I am with ahydra - 2 overcall finishing in 4. When you think you have found a good auction to slam, try switching the pointy kings. It just seems very anti-percentage to go hunting for a low-hcp slam on hands like these after the opps open.
